A woman shot dead three people and injured three more before turning a gun on herself in an attack at a warehouse complex in Maryland, US police say. | A woman shot dead three people and injured three more before turning a gun on herself in an attack at a warehouse complex in Maryland, US police say. |
The shooting happened on Thursday morning at a pharmacy distribution centre in Perryman, near Baltimore. | The shooting happened on Thursday morning at a pharmacy distribution centre in Perryman, near Baltimore. |
The attacker, Snochia Moseley, 26, died from a self-inflicted gunshot wound. The motive for her attack is unclear. | The attacker, Snochia Moseley, 26, died from a self-inflicted gunshot wound. The motive for her attack is unclear. |
Mass shootings by women are rare, with more than 95% of such attacks in the US carried out by men. | Mass shootings by women are rare, with more than 95% of such attacks in the US carried out by men. |
The victims who died included Sunday Aguda, 45, Brindra Giri, 41, and Hayleen Reyes, 41, police said on Friday. | |
'Officers fired no shots' | 'Officers fired no shots' |
The shooter was a temporary employee who reported for work as usual that morning, Harford County Sheriff's Office said. | The shooter was a temporary employee who reported for work as usual that morning, Harford County Sheriff's Office said. |
But shortly after 09:00 local time (13:00 GMT) she began shooting outside, then inside the facility, with a 9mm Glock handgun that she had brought with her. | But shortly after 09:00 local time (13:00 GMT) she began shooting outside, then inside the facility, with a 9mm Glock handgun that she had brought with her. |
Police were on the scene within five minutes, by which time the shooter had killed three people and injured three more. | Police were on the scene within five minutes, by which time the shooter had killed three people and injured three more. |
Officers found the suspect in a critical condition, with a self-inflicted gunshot wound to the head - she died later in hospital. | Officers found the suspect in a critical condition, with a self-inflicted gunshot wound to the head - she died later in hospital. |
She was from Baltimore County, police said. | She was from Baltimore County, police said. |
She legally owned and had registered the handgun, and had taken several magazines of ammunition with her, police said. | |
The sheriff's office initially urged residents to avoid the area, which is about 40km (25 miles) north-east of Baltimore, as hundreds of employees evacuated the facility and nearby buildings. | |
Shooter became 'increasingly agitated' | |
Investigators say the suspect was "suffering from a mental illness and over the last two weeks had become increasingly agitated". | |
They say she had been employed at the facility for less than two weeks before the attack. | |
She had no criminal arrest record, but had her car stopped three times in the area in just the past month. | |
The suspect was issued tickets for not having proper vehicle registration, among other infractions, according to the Baltimore Sun newspaper. | |
Authorities have described her as "disgruntled". A school friend told the newspaper that she was not an angry person but felt the "world was against her". |
